How they compare
Zimbabwe currently reports 0.9678 GPIA against 0.9642 GPIA in Uganda, a difference of 0.0036 GPIA.
Across all 10 years both countries report, Zimbabwe has been ahead every year.
Uganda ranks 174th and Zimbabwe ranks 172nd of 206 countries.
Zimbabwe has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Uganda | Zimbabwe |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970s | 0.6747 GPIA | 0.7851 GPIA | 0.1104 GPIA | Zimbabwe |
| 1980s | 0.7372 GPIA | 0.9249 GPIA | 0.1877 GPIA | Zimbabwe |
| 1990s | 0.7572 GPIA | 0.9162 GPIA | 0.159 GPIA | Zimbabwe |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
